How
this Web site is Organized
This
web site has been developed, based on a Hudson River Watershed Council's
publication, to provide the reader with a roadmap for developing a communications
plan. This particular project was undertaken by the Huron River Watershed
Council with the idea that two end products would result from the process:
1) The HRWC would have a working communications plan for the organization
which could be implemented, and 2) The HRWC would be able to provide
others with information on how to create a communications plan for themselves.
You
will notice that under each section on the navagation bar are two divisions,
Process and HRWC. For each section of this website, there is a Process
division, which explains the methodology for developing a communications
plan of your own. Also for each section, there is a HRWC division, which
explains the process the HRWC went through within their own organization
to accomplish each step.
